#aec9b5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aec9b5 is composed of 68.2% red, 78.8%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 10%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 135.6 degrees, a saturation of 20% and a lightness of 73.5%. #aec9b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5d936b.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#aec9b5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#aec9b5 has RGB values of R:174, G:201,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 11454901.

Shades and Tints of #aec9b5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f5f8f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#aec9b5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8bfba is the less saturated color, while #7afd9c is the most saturated one.
